How Corroded Pipe Water Removal Actually Works
Our team follows a meticulous process to ensure your property is thoroughly cleaned and restored. We’ll assess the damage, extract the water, dry the area, and disinfect to prevent mold growth. Our technicians use state-of-the-art equipment and IICRC-certified techniques to guarantee a safe and efficient outcome.
Assessment and Planning
Our team will inspect your property to find out the extent of the damage. We’ll identify the source of the leak, assess the affected areas, and create a customized plan to address the issue. Our technicians will explain the process, answer your questions, and provide a detailed estimate.
Water Extraction
We’ll use powerful pumps and wet vacuums to remove the standing water and extract moisture from the affected areas. Our technicians will work efficiently to reduce downtime and prevent further damage.
Drying and Dehumidification
Our team will use industrial-grade dehumidifiers and air movers to dry the affected areas. We’ll monitor the moisture levels and adjust the equipment as needed to ensure a thorough drying process.
Disinfection and Sanitizing
Our technicians will apply disinfectants and sanitizers to remove bacteria, mold, and other microorganisms. We’ll ensure your property is safe and healthy for you and your family.
Final Inspection and Clean-up
We’ll conduct a thorough inspection to ensure your property is restored to its original condition. Our team will clean and disinfect any affected areas, and provide a final walk-through to guarantee your satisfaction.

Warning Signs You Need Corroded Pipe Water Removal
Ignoring corroded pipe issues can lead to costly repairs, health hazards, and even property damage. Be aware of these warning signs and take action quickly: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Unpleasant odors can show mold growth, which can be a sign of corroded pipes. If you notice persistent musty smells, it’s essential to investigate the source.
Water Stains and Warping
Visible water stains or warping on walls, ceilings, or floors can show a corroded pipe issue. Don’t ignore these signs, as they can lead to further damage and costly repairs.
Unexplained Water Bills
Unexpected spikes in your water bill can show a leak or corroded pipe issue. Investigate the cause to prevent unnecessary expenses and potential health hazards.
Low Water Pressure
Reduced water pressure can be a sign of corroded pipes or mineral buildup. Address the issue quickly to prevent further damage and ensure your family’s comfort.
Discolored or Cloudy Water
Visible discoloration or cloudiness in your water can show a corroded pipe issue. Don’t drink or use this water until it’s properly tested and treated.
Growths or Fungi on Surfaces
Visible growths or fungi on surfaces can be a sign of mold or mildew, which can be caused by corroded pipes. Address the issue quickly to prevent health hazards and property damage.
Corroded Pipe Water Removal vs. DIY: When to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small leak in a bathroom or kitchen | Yes | No | Easy to fix with a DIY repair kit and some basic plumbing skills. |
| Large-scale water damage from a burst pipe | No | Yes | Needs specialized equipment and expertise to extract water, dry the area, and prevent mold growth. |
| Corroded pipes in a hidden area (e.g., behind walls or under floors) | No | Yes | Needs specialized equipment and expertise to access and repair the pipes without causing further damage. |
| Water damage from a flooded basement or crawl space | No | Yes | Needs specialized equipment and expertise to extract water, dry the area, and prevent mold growth. |
| Discolored or cloudy water from corroded pipes | No | Yes | Needs specialized equipment and expertise to test and treat the water, as well as repair the corroded pipes. |
